Cell won't print in color

Posted by Eric on October 08, 2001 5:46 PM
I am trying to print 2 or 3 cells on a worksheet in
color, something I have done many times before, but
for some reason, this time they print in black. This
is on a spreadsheet I did not create, I am just
modifying it. Any ideas on what is causing this?

Re: Cell won't print in color

Posted by Don C on October 09, 2001 5:01 AM
Check the paper size required. Our printer allows color on 11" paper but not on 14" paper. Legal sized printouts are black or various shades of grey (depending on the color).
